My Week with Marilyn is a 2011 British biographical film, directed by Simon Curtis and written by Adrian Hodges. The film is based on Colin Clark's books, The Prince, the Showgirl and Me and My Week with Marilyn, which chronicle Clark's experiences working as an assistant on the set of the 1957 film The Prince and the Showgirl, which starred Marilyn Monroe and Laurence Olivier.

Eddie Redmayne stars as Colin Clark, a recent graduate of Eton College who is eager to break into the film industry. He lands a job as a third assistant director on The Prince and the Showgirl, where he meets Marilyn Monroe, played by Michelle Williams.

From the moment Marilyn arrives in London, she is constantly hounded by reporters and fans. Her marriage to playwright Arthur Miller is on the rocks, and she is insecure about her acting abilities. Laurence Olivier, played by Kenneth Branagh, is frustrated by Marilyn's erratic behavior and her inability to remember her lines.

As Colin gets to know Marilyn, he becomes her confidant and friend. He accompanies her on outings around London, and she asks him to read lines with her in her hotel room. Marilyn is impressed by Colin's youth and innocence, and seeks his advice on her acting. They have a brief romance, but Marilyn ultimately returns to Miller.

My Week with Marilyn was praised for its performances, particularly Williams' portrayal of Marilyn Monroe. The film received two Academy Award nominations: one for Williams for Best Actress, and one for Branagh for Best Supporting Actor.
